Explanation: 1. Justification for Option 3: One crore - In the Indian numbering system, "lakh" and "crore" are commonly used units. One lakh is equal to 100,000. Therefore, one hundred lakh is calculated as 100 x 100,000, which equals 10,000,000. In the Indian numbering system, 10,000,000 is referred to as "one crore."
